Introduction

Unit Controls

LIGHT/POWER: controls backlight level and turns unit on/off

KEYPAD: controls cursor & selects items on menus

PAGES: allows you to select a page to view

MENU: opens settings, context and page menus

ENTER: finalizes menu selections

ZOOM Keys: (+) used to zoom in; (-) used to zoom out

Conventional sonar and DownScan

This unit supports two types of sonar: Conventional and DownScan.

Refer to the “Sonar Operation” section for information about conventional sonar features and settings.

DownScan features and settings are covered in the “DownScan Operation” section.

Basic Operation

Setup wizard

The Setup wizard will appear when the unit is turned on for the first time. To choose your own settings, do not run the setup wizard. To restart the Setup wizard, restore defaults.

Selecting Pages

To select a page, press the keypad in the direction of the desired page and press Enter.

Pages

This unit has four pages: DownScan, Sonar, Sonar/Downscan (vertical) and Sonar/Downscan (horizontal).

Page menus

The DownScan and Sonar pages have menus that can only be accessed when those pages are displayed.

Working with menus

There are several menu types used to make adjustments to options and settings, including scrollbars, on/off features and dropdown menus.

Scrollbars

Select the scrollbar and press the keypad left (decrease) or right (increase).

On/Off features

Select an on/off menu item and press Enter to turn it on/off.

NOTE: Press the Menu key to exit menus.

Dialogs

Dialogs are used for user input or for presenting information to the user. Depending on the type of entry, different methods are used to confirm, cancel or close the dialog.

Dropdown menus

Access the dropdown menu, press the keypad up/ down to select the desired item and press Enter.

Entering text

To input text:

1.Use the keypad to select the desired character and press enter.

2.Repeat Step 1 for each character.

3.When entry is completed, highlight OK and press enter.

Switches letters to uppercase/ lowercase

Switches keyboard between ALPHA and QWERTY layout

Fishing Modes

(Conventional sonar only)

Fishing modes enhance the performance of your unit by providing preset packages of sonar settings geared to specific fishing conditions.

Cursor

The keypad moves the cursor around the display and allows you to review sonar history.

Advanced Mode

Enables advanced features and settings.

The following features are enabled when Advanced mode is turned on:

NMEA 0183 configuration options

Units (Enables depth and temperature configuration options)

Basic Operation | Elite-5x HDI

8

Standby mode

Lowers power consumption by turning off sonar and the display.

1.Press the PWR/Light key to access the Backlight dialog.

2.Select Standby and press Enter.

3.Press any key to resume normal operation.

Restore defaults

Sets unit options and settings to default values.

NOTE: Leaving your unit in Standby mode when your boat is not in use will run down your battery.
